Maruti Evans has designed scenery and lighting for theater and opera.

His productions include Real Enemies, Epiphany, Liederabend and Else Where (BAM), Witness Uganda, Alive vs. Wonderland and Mouth Wide Open (A.R.T.), Much Ado About Nothing (A.R.T. and McCarter Theater), Big Apple Circus (2015 and 2016), Cool Hand Luke, Deliverance and Cafe Society Swing (59e59), Master and Margarita (SummerScape), An Oresteia (Classic Stage Co), Crowns (Goodman Theater), Ballad of Emmett Till, Owl Answers and The Dutchman (Penumbra Theater), Tosca (Opera Colorado), The Marriage of Figaro (Florida Grand Opera), The Marriage of Figaro, Orfeo and The Turn of the Screw (Stonybrook Opera) and Sweeney Todd (Virginia Opera).

He has received the Drama Desk Award in 2013 for designing Tiny Dynamite and Pilo Family Circus and Drama Desk nominations for Deliverance, In the Heat of the Night, Slaughterhouse 5 and Blindness.
